'No Trial, Forced Confession': Young Baha'i Community Prisoner In Iran Faces Torture, Sparking Global Concern
Published on: March 26, 2026, 11:17 a.m. | Source: Free Press Journal
Peyvand Naimi, a young Baha’i man detained in Iran since January 8, is allegedly facing severe torture, including mock executions, without trial. Rights groups say his confession was forced and charges fabricated. With worsening health and no medical care, international organisations are urging urgent intervention to protect his life.
